Protection of Children Codes of PracticeContribution
Regarding what some regard as safe harbour, which other noble Lords mentioned, we believe it would not be desirable or effective to remove aspects of the framework that require Ofcom to publish pre-emptive guidance about how far providers need to go to fulfil their duties. That would be likely to create an uncertain and unclear operating environment, reducing legal certainty for services, Ofcom and users. It could also lead to more legal challenges and obstacles to delivering the vital safety benefits that this legislation provides.
